YOUR DBS PATIENT MAY NEED AN MRI

APPROXIMATELY 7 OUT OF 10
DBS-eligible patients with movement disorders may need an MRI within 10 years of receiving their device.2

Pictogram highlighting 7 out of 10 people

38% OF MRI EXAMINATIONS
of DBS-eligible patients with movement disorders are in the head, jaw, and neck.2

62% OF MRI EXAMINATIONS
of DBS-eligible patients with movement disorders are in the body.2

We performed 14 years1 of rigorous MRI research and testing to demonstrate the safety of our devices for MRI, including 38,000 scan conditions1† and 10 million1 simulated patient scans.

  1. Filtered feedthrough technology mitigates radiofrequency (RF) energy from entering and damaging the device.

  2. Minimal ferrous material reduces potential for unwanted device and lead movement caused by magnetic pull.

  3. Protection diodes help prevent failure when exposed to electromagnetic interference.

Medtronic DBS systems are MR Conditional which means they are safe for MRI scans only under certain conditions. If the conditions are not met, the MRI could cause tissue heating, especially at the implanted lead(s) in the brain, which may result in serious and permanent injury or death. Before having an MRI, always talk with the doctor who manages your DBS Therapy to determine your eligibility and discuss potential benefits and risks of MRI.
